If the compressibility of water is `sigma` per unit atmospheric pressure, then the decrease in volume V due to atmospheric pressure P will be

A

`sigma p//V`

B

`sigma pV`

C

`sigma //pV`

D

`sigma V//P`

Text Solution

Verified by Experts

The correct Answer is:
b

`B = (p)/((Delta V)/(V))` or `(1)/(B) = (Delta V / V)/(p)`
`implies sigma = (Delta V)/(pV)` or `Delta V = sigma p V`
